Pretty good. Typical "I didn't know I had a child with you" storyline except that the child was 10 years old and played a big part in the storyline.

Returning to Cypress Landing brings back the best-- and worst--moments of Cade Wheeler's life. Because the bayou was where he'd first tasted the sweetness of love and the bitterness of loss.
Ten years ago Brijette Dupre had been a pregnant backwoods girl who felt her only choice was to accept the Wheelers' money--to leave Cade alone. She couldn't know his family had lied to them both.
Now Cade's back. Considering their past relationship and current attraction, working with him is hard enough. Add to the mix his unknown daughter--the daughter Brijette had kept despite the Wheelers' demands--and it becomes close to impossible.
